Dandelion tea is made from the roots of the dandelion or wish flower, as my kids call it. Once it has been roasted and ground up, it resembles coffee and acts as a great substitute especially if you are trying to limit your coffee intake.  It is also packed full of anti-aging antioxidants like coffee and is rich in vitamins and minerals, including vitamins B and C, along with Calcium, Potassium, Magnesium, Zinc and Iron.

Dandelion tea also has a detoxification function and can act as a natural diuretic, as it purifies the blood, cleansing the liver and kidney in the process. It is also said to help aid in digestion, reduce bloating and clear your skin. In TCM, we value dandelion tea to help with liver disharmonies.
